Saturday, March 20, 2010. Jose Salinas, former commissioner Pct. 2 candidate is endorsing Judith Gutierrez for the County Commissioner Pct. 2 race against incubent Wawi Tijerina. Tijerina is upset at his endorsement and is saying Gutierrez offered Salinas a job with the county in exchange for the endorsement. Monday, March 1, 2010. Police on alert after Nuevo Laredo violence. Laredo police are on alert as of Monday night on International Bridge #1 due to reports of violence once again occurring in the sister city of Nuevo Laredo. A police spokesman says officials are on standby to deter any possible spill over from the sister city. Police officials urge Laredoan to stay away from traveling into Nuevo Laredo at this time. Sunday, February 28, 2010. Early voting is slow. Oscar Villarreal, Webb County's election administrator said that only about 19,000 citizens went to the polls early to vote.
